开源项目:WordPress Playground Tools 指南

开源项目:WordPress Playground Tools 指南

playground-tools playground-tools 项目地址: https://gitcode.com/gh_mirrors/pl/playground-tools

项目介绍

WordPress Playground Tools 是一个专为 WordPress 开发环境设计的开源工具集,旨在简化开发者在搭建和维护测试或开发环境过程中的复杂度。此项目提供了各种实用工具和脚本,帮助开发者快速创建、管理和实验不同的 WordPress 配置和插件设置,提升开发效率和体验。它包含了自动化部署脚本、数据库管理工具以及一些定制化的环境配置助手。

项目快速启动

要快速启动并运行 WordPress Playground Tools,首先确保您的系统已安装 Git 和 Node.js(推荐版本 >= 14.x)。

  1. 克隆仓库
    使用以下命令从 GitHub 克隆项目到本地:

    git clone https://github.com/WordPress/playground-tools.git
    
  2. 安装依赖
    进入项目目录并安装必要的Node包:

    cd playground-tools
    npm install
    
  3. 启动项目
    安装完成后,可以使用以下命令启动项目:

    npm run start
    

    此命令将执行预定义的脚本,初始化并运行你的WordPress开发环境。

  4. 访问你的开发环境
    项目启动后,通常会在默认的端口上运行(如 http://localhost:8000),具体端口可能依据配置文件而定。打开浏览器即可访问你的WordPress沙盒环境。

应用案例和最佳实践

  • 快速原型开发:利用该工具集,开发者可以在短时间内搭建多个不同配置的WordPress环境,适合进行功能原型的快速迭代。
  • 插件与主题测试:为新开发的WordPress插件或主题提供一个隔离的测试环境,避免影响生产环境。
  • 教育训练:在教学场景中,可以轻松创建多个相同的开发环境,供学员学习和练习使用。

最佳实践:

  • 在开始任何重大改动之前,利用版本控制备份重要数据。
  • 使用Docker容器化技术(如果支持)来进一步隔离环境,便于跨机器迁移。
  • 遵循项目文档中关于环境变量的最佳配置指导,以最大化安全性与灵活性。

典型生态项目

虽然提供的链接并未直接指向包含这些信息的具体开源项目页面,但基于假设和WordPress社区的一般生态,典型的生态项目可能包括:

  • WordPress Docker Compose配置:结合Docker技术,提供一套完整的WordPress运行环境配置,包括MySQL数据库和WordPress本身。
  • Git subtree管理:对于需要深度集成WordPress核心或其他GitHub仓库的项目,使用Git subtree策略管理项目依赖。
  • WordPress REST API插件开发示例:展示如何利用WordPress REST API构建前后端分离的应用或插件。
  • 自动化部署脚本:利用Jenkins、GitLab CI/CD等工具,实现从代码提交到部署测试环境的自动化流程。

请注意,上述“典型生态项目”部分是基于对WordPress生态系统一般情况的假设,并非直接源自给定的项目链接,因为原链接并未提供具体项目内容详情。实际项目内容应参考仓库中的README或其他官方文档获取最新和最准确的信息。

playground-tools playground-tools 项目地址: https://gitcode.com/gh_mirrors/pl/playground-tools

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

贾雁冰

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值